What is a potential limitation of PCR?
Steps
Concepts
Step 1: Understand what PCR is. PCR stands for Polymerase Chain Reaction, a method used to make many copies of a specific DNA segment.
Step 2: Know that PCR needs DNA to work. The DNA used must be of good quality.
Step 3: Learn about contaminants. Contaminants are unwanted substances that can mix with the DNA.
Step 4: Realize that if the DNA has contaminants, it can stop PCR from working properly.
Step 5: Understand that if PCR doesn't work well, the results can be incorrect or unreliable.
